Popular IQ Assessments Utilized in Elementary College Admissions

The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for Children, Fifth Edition (WISC-V) stands given that the most generally administered specific intelligence examination for college-age kids. This complete evaluation evaluates 5 Major cognitive domains: verbal comprehension, visual spatial processing, fluid reasoning, working memory, and processing velocity. The WISC-V generally will take involving 65 to 80 minutes to accomplish and supplies both equally an entire Scale IQ score and particular person index scores for every cognitive region.

The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Edition represents Yet another often employed assessment Device. This examination measures 5 cognitive aspects: fluid reasoning, understanding, quantitative reasoning, visual-spatial processing, and dealing memory. The Stanford-Binet is especially valued for its ability to evaluate young children across a variety of intellectual abilities and is commonly chosen for evaluating gifted students resulting from its large ceiling scores.

The Kaufman Evaluation Battery for youngsters, 2nd Version (KABC-II) gives another approach to cognitive assessment, specializing in the two sequential and simultaneous psychological processing skills. This exam is especially handy for analyzing young children from various cultural backgrounds, since it features both equally verbal and nonverbal scales that could be administered individually when language barriers could impact effectiveness.

Group-administered assessments similar to the Otis-Lennon School Capacity Take a look at (OLSAT) are occasionally used in Preliminary screening processes. These assessments Appraise verbal, quantitative, and figural reasoning abilities and can be administered to a number of pupils at the same time, creating them Charge-productive for colleges processing big figures of apps.

Interpreting Scores and Knowledge Benefits

IQ scores are typically claimed as typical scores using a imply of 100 and an ordinary deviation of 15. Therefore about 68 per cent of children rating between eighty five and 115, when scores over a hundred thirty are typically thought of to indicate giftedness. Having said that, private educational facilities could established their very own thresholds for admission, with a few demanding scores over selected percentiles.

It is really essential to know that IQ scores represent functionality on a selected working day and may not capture the complete spectrum of the Kid's skills or likely. Things like examination stress and anxiety, fatigue, cultural background, and prior academic activities can all affect general performance. In addition, distinct assessments may well generate slightly various success for a similar child, emphasizing the significance of viewing these scores as a single piece of a larger puzzle as an alternative to definitive actions of intelligence.
